Israeli Health Tech Startups Nab Innovation Awards In Taiwan

Two Israeli wellbeing tech startups Sanolla and Naor (Speedy Diagnostics), were awarded the Breakthrough Innovation Award at the InoVEX 2022 Pitch Contest held in Taiwan this 7 days. The award had a total of 7 winners.

The two firms also gained the Startup Terrace Award, which contains a $40,000 grant and workplaces at Startup Terrace Innovation Centre, a facility supported by the Tiny and Medium Enterprise Administration of Taiwan’s Ministry of Economic Affairs.

Held annually since 2016, InnoVEX is the Asia Innovation Conference for startups and is aspect of COMPUTEX TAIPEI, a major technological innovation exhibition that draws in hundreds of taking part organizations from around 20 countries and about 10,000 people, which includes hundreds of global traders. 145 total organizations from 14 nations participated this year. 

Established in 2016, Sanolla develops clinical analysis and patient monitoring options with its patented AI-primarily based infrasound auscultation know-how and gives a selection of AI-driven diagnostic options for key care doctors. 

Founded in 2020, Quick Diagnostics formulated an ground breaking motor for speedy molecular and on-web-site prognosis that needs zero lab infrastructure. It is relevant for COVID-19 as perfectly as a range of other infectious diseases. 

Sanolla, Immediate Diagnostics, and Israeli air purification enterprise Airovation, took element in InnoVEX 2022 as aspect of the 3rd cycle of the IP²LaunchPad method for the accelerated entry of Israeli organizations into much east markets and Taiwanese innovation ecosystem. The IP²LaunchPad plan is used to accelerate the innovation ecosystem in Taiwan and will work in conjunction with the Taiwanese government’s $1 billion investment decision by 2023 to set up its position as “Asia’s Silicon Valley”. Due to entry constraints, the companies participated remotely.
